A month should be more than enough time to go through the LR Bible, unless you're incredibly busy, in which case I hope you plan to start studying for the LSAT very early.

I didn't drastically improve immediately after going through the LR Bible (though it's hard to say since I only did 1 PT beforehand), but as you go through the PTs, you understand better just what is being asked and how to answer.

By and far the most important part of studying for the LSAT is doing the PTs (I did the 30 most recent, and that's what I tell people they should do at a minimum, I regret not starting way early and doing all the PTs) AND thoroughly reviewing the aftermath. For EVERY SINGLE QUESTION you should know why the right answer is right. For EVERY QUESTION YOU GET WRONG you should know what you did wrong. For LG, know how to diagram as best as possible. If you can't diagram well, you sink. If you do, you swim to the next section. The LG Bible teaches you how to diagram very well. That is why LG Bible is king of LSAT prep (though the PTs are the LSAT prep).

It took me less than a month to get through the LRB, and that was while working FT and devoting only an hour or two everyday after work to getting through it. I saw improvements right away -- I went from missing 8-10 total to missing 1-4 total. I'd highly recommend the LRB. I would, however, also recommend doing more than just the LRB because that's all I did in terms of prep work for LR, and my scores would still occasionally dip lower (ie into the -5 to -10 range).
